    Content: This book tells the story of a short-lived but vehement eugenics movement that emerged among a group of Europeans in Kenya in the 1930s, unleashing a set of writings on racial differences in intelligence more extreme than that emanating from any other British colony in the twentieth century. Through a close examination of attitudes towards race and intelligence in a British colony, it reveals how eugenics was central to colonial racial theories before World War Two
